WebOct 1, 2001 · Dexmedetomidine. Precedex (Abbott) 2 mL ampoules containing 100 microgram/mL. Approved indication: sedation. Australian Medicines Handbook Section 2.2. For several years it has been known that the antihypertensive drug clonidine can reduce the required dose of anaesthetic drugs. It does this by stimulating alpha 2 adrenoceptors. Webpressure (BIPAP). In the DUOPAP mode, PDuo is the maximum pressure that is alternately applied to the previous baseline CPAP. Breathing rate is the number of PDuo applied per minute [12]. DUOPAP respiratory support increases mean airway pressure, tidal volume and minute ventilation and subsequently improves hypoxia and CO 2 retention [12].
